Founded in 1875, Hebrew Union College (HUC) is the Reform Movement's seminary. Aspiring rabbis, cantors, and educators spend one full year in Jerusalem and then complete their studies at one of 3 campuses in the U.S. (Cincinnati, New York, and Los Angeles). Mark's curriculum this year focuses on Hebrew language and life in Israel, with courses in Bible, history, philosophy, literature, Biblical grammar, and practical rabbinics. Additionally, all students take part in various community service projects around Jerusalem. In subsequent years, studies will expand further into Jewish law, ritual, modern thought, counseling, and preparation for an active role in the Jewish community. Find out more: HUC
